Marlborough Residents to Star in SPECTACULAR SPECTACULAR!!!

Moonstruck Theater Company Announces A New Musical Revue: SPECTACULAR SPECTACULAR!!!


Framingham-based MOONSTRUCK THEATER COMPANY, in association with Amazing Things Art Center, is pleased to present SPECTACULAR SPECTACULAR!!!, opening Friday, July 18, and running for four performances through July 20. Performances will take place at Amazing Things Art Center, 160 Hollis St., Framingham, MA.


SPECTACULAR SPECTACULAR!!! is an original musical revue about putting on a musical revue, featuring songs from all of your favorite Broadway shows and Hollywood films.  Musicals featured include Moulin Rouge, Anything Goes, Wicked, West Side Story, Hairspray, Pippin, The Producers, Mamma Mia, Les Miserables, and Frozen--and many more!

The production features 20 performers from the Boston and MetroWest regions, including Marlborough residents Shannon Hinkley singing “If My Friends Could See Me Now” from Sweet Charity, Jonathan McCauley singing “Maria” from West Side Story, and Nick McKinnon performing “Anything You Can Do” from Annie Get Your Gun (a duet with Lowell resident Stacy Kadesch). All three also perform alongside the ensemble in all dance numbers.

Shannon Hinkley has participated in theater for almost 20 years, and of SPECTACULAR SPECTACULAR!!! she says “I am so proud to be a member of this cast. The show has a few surprises in store for the audience and I can't wait for people to be able to see this. The songs chosen highlight the strengths of each individual performer and highlight the casts uniformity and talents. It's a can't miss!” When not performing, Shannon works full-time as a client service Relationship Advisor for Silicon Valley Bank out of Newton, MA.


Jonathan McCauley is performing for the sixth time with Moonstruck Theater Company, after spending the last four seasons playing Mr Mushnik in Little Shop of Horrors, Ernst Ludwig in Cabaret, Glen Guglia in The Wedding Singer, Mr. Myers in Fame, and Mr. McQueen in Urinetown: The Musical. “SPECTACULAR SPECTACULAR!!! has something for everyone,” says McCauley, “You’ll laugh, you’ll cry, you’ll shriek, and you’ll have a heck of a good time.” Originally from Ohio, Jon is also a trained opera singer.

Nick McKinnon, a transplant to the Bay State from Maine, moved to Massachusetts to attend Worcester Polytechnic Institute. SPECTACULAR SPECTACULAR!!! marks his return to Moonstruck Theater Company, having participated in their production of Urinetown: The Musical three years ago and most recently in Little Shop of Horrors last fall. A theater orchestra musician since the age of 12, McKinnon was very familiar with many of the songs before auditioning. “This show focuses on some of the top songs from many great productions.  Everyone, even those less familiar with theater, will recognize and enjoy their favorites throughout the event!” Off-stage, Nick is an electrical engineer that frequently travels around the world for his company.  Free-time adventures consist of rock climbing and going on as many destination vacations as possible with friends.

The show is directed by Matthew Sherman and music directed by Samantha Prindiville. The production will be presented at Amazing Things Art Center, Framingham, MA.


Tickets are $25 for general admission, $24 for senior citizens and students, $22 for Amazing Things Members, and $13 for children 12 and under.
